I also unearthed this at the colonial house on the same day as the shoe buckle. I was a real suprise as it was only about 2" deep and rang up as a shallow cent.

A few treatments with Al jelly seems to have revealed some amazing detail! I'm not sure what it was, but it may have been a brooch or sorts. It appears that a stone may have been attached to the front. Definitely one of my more beatiful relics and another treat from this colonial house.
